Dice are small, throwable objects used to generate random values in various forms of gambling and a wide variety of games.
While six-sided, cubical dice are by far the most common, polyhedral dice with 4, 8, 10, 12, and 20 sides appear frequently in specific settings, particularly in table-top Dungeons & Dragons and its many descendants.
